American Film Institute Catalog on CD-ROM
Also available online: American Film Institute Catalog Online

The American Film Institute Catalog represents the only comprehensive project to document a century of American film; originally compiled in six printed volumes, the Catalog documents every American film from 1893 to 1970 (except 1951 to 1960). It is a unique filmographic resource providing an unmatched level of comprehensiveness and detail on every feature-length film produced in America or financed by American production companies.

L'Année Philologique (Paris: Sociéte d'édition "Les Belles Lettres.", 1926- .)
SML, CD-ROM Reference Center
SML, Reference Z7016 A55 (LC)
Classics, CD-ROM
Classics G2 36
Divinity, Reserve CDR0013
Divinity, Trowbridge Reading Room Z7016 M35 (LC)

The major bibliography for classical studies from 1926 to the present is available both in print and on CD-ROM. Issued on CD-ROM as the Database of Classical Bibliography (DCB), which covers from 1976 - 1987.
Continues: Marouzeau, Jules. Dix Anneacutees de Bibliographie Classique [ 1914-1924] (New York:B. Franklin, 1969) - SML, Reference, TBA.
Lambrino, Scarlat. Bibliographie de L'antiquité Classique, 1896-1914 (Paris: Socieé d'édition "Les Belles Lettres.", 1951) - SML, Reference, TBA

Bibliographie der deutschen Sprach- und Literaturwissenschaft (Frankfurt am Main, V. Klostermann, 1990-1998).
SML, CD-ROM Reference Center (1990-1998)
SML, Reference Z2231  B53 (LC) (1945- )
CCL, German Reading Rm, Lower Level X582 B453 (1945-1971)

Dating back to 1945, the "Eppelsheimer-Köttelwesch" is a major, international bibliography for German literary studies (formerly Bibliographie der deutschen Literaturwissenschaft). Despite the change in title, there is still less emphasis on linguistics. The earliest volumes have been cumulated as the Bibliographisches Handbuch der deutschen Literaturwissenschaft, 1945-1972, (Frankfurt am Main, V. Klostermann, 1973-1979), SML Ref Z2231 K64 (LC). The CD-Rom covers 1990 to 1998 only.

Catálogo Colectivo de Fondo Antiguo, siglos XV-XIX (Chadwyck-Healey, 1995)
SML, CD-ROM Reference Center

Produced by the Asociación de Bibliotecas Nacionales de Iberoamerica (ABINIA), Catálogo Colectivo de Fondo Antiguo, siglos XV-XIX is the largest union catalog in Latin America, containing 100,000 bibliographic records of books relating to the history and culture of Iberoamerica published before 1900 held in 22 national libraries of Central and South America, Spain and Portugal, as well as three major universities in Venezuela.

Historical Statistics of the United States (Cambridge: Cambridge University Press, 1997)
SML, CD-ROM Reference Center
SML, Reference Desk HA202 +A23 1975 (LC)

This electronic edition of the Historical Statistics of the United States reproduces all of the data and text contained in the U.S. Census Bureau's 1975 publication. This massive compendium includes 57 chapters on topics touching all of the social, behavioral, humanitistic, and natural sciences including economics, finance, sociology, demography, education, law, natural resources, climate, religion, international migration, and trade. Over 12,500 statistical time series are presented.

Index Translationum (Evanston, IL: ATLA, 1994- )
SML, CD-ROM Reference Center
SML, Reference Z6514 T7 +I42 (LC) (1948-1986)
SML, Reference Z6514 T7 I4 (LC) (1932-1940)

This edition on CD-ROM is the cumulative bibliographic index of works translated and published since 1979 in more than 100 countries, from Albania to Zimbabwe. It comprises over 815,000 references covering every subject (literature, social and human sciences, natural and basic sciences, art and history, etc.). It is a valuable instrument for rapid retrieval of references on works translated by more than 150,000 authors: Cervantes, Agatha Christie, Einstein, Flaubert, Freud, Gandhi, Grimm, Herg, Lenin, etc. Each bibliographical entry includes name of author, title of the translation, name of translator, name of publisher, year of publication, original language, number of pages. The entries are arranged according to the ten main categories of the Universal Decimal Classification (UDC) system. The CD-ROM replaces the printed edition, which is no longer published.

International Medieval Bibliography (Leeds, England: University of Leeds, 1967- )
SML, CD-ROM Reference Center
SML, Reference Z6203 I585 (LC)

A classed bibliography with a subject index which includes citations to articles on a broad range of medieval (450-1500 A.D.) subjects from over 800 journals and many collected works (Festschriften, conference proceedings, and collected essays). The geographic area of coverage includes all of Europe and the Middle East "...for those areas subsequently controlled by Christian powers; it thus includes... non-European parts of the Byzantine Empire." (Introduction). The IMB is available in print and on CD-ROM. The CD-ROM covers the years 1976-1995, while the printed volumes date back to 1967.

Niles' Register: Cumulative Index, 1811-1849 (Malvern, PA: Accessible Archives, 1994)
SML, CD-ROM Reference Center

The Accessible Archives CD-ROM of The Niles' Register: Cumulative Index, 1811-1849, permits instant accessibility to the vast storehouse of historical and genealogical materials contained in this important work.  This database contains approximately 350,000 listings, including all the material from the original volume-by-volume indices, together with tens of thousands of additional entries in a highly analytical and structured format.  Ambiguous and idiosyncratic entries in the original six-month indices have been edited into meaningful entries under standardized, library-style headings and subheadings.

Nineteenth Century Short Title Catalogue (Newcastle upon Tyne: Avero, 1997) Series I - III
SML, CD-ROM Reference Center
SML, Reference Z2001 +N65 1984 (LC)

The Nineteenth Century Short Title Catalogue (NSTC) Project was established in 1983. It aims to provide increasingly complete listings of British books printed between 1801 and 1919. British books are taken to include all books published in Britain, its colonies and the United States of America; all books in English wherever published; and all translations from English. The catalogue has been prepared from the in-house and published catalogues of the libraries covered. The individual catalogues within each contributing library have been indicated by appropriate symbols, as listed below in parentheses. In note fields these library symbols have been used for information about holdings or author headings at specific libraries, e.g. CH have vol. 2 only, that is Cambridge University Library and Harvard have vol. 2 only.

  • OXFORD - The Bodleian Library- The pre-1920 computerised catalogue (O) Supplementary entries (O1)
  • CAMBRIDGE - University Library - The main catalogue of 1,225 guardbook volumes (C) The secondary catalogue of copyright acquisitions considered unnecessary for the academic needs of the main catalogue (C1) The pamphlet catalogue (C2)
  • DUBLIN - Trinity College Library - The printed catalogue of books up to 1872, with supplements to 1887 (D) The accessions catalogue 1873-1962 (D1) The older printed books card catalogue, 1963- (D2)
  • EDINBURGH - National Library of Scotland - The main card catalogue, pre-1974 (E)
  • HARVARD - Harvard University Library - The Widener union catalogue (H)
  • LONDON - The British Library - The British Library computerised catalogue, with accessions to 1995 (L)
  • NEWCASTLE - The University Library - The University computerised catalogue (N)
  • WASHINGTON - The Library of Congress - A computerised sorting of nineteenth century holdings from the MARC and PRE-MARC files (W)

Wing Short-Title Catalogue, 1641-1700 (Alexandria, VA: Chadwyck-Healy, 1996)
SML, CD-ROM Reference Center
SML, Reference Z2002 +W55 (LC)

This database gives the first electronic access to Donald Wing's Short-Title Catalogue of Books Printed in England, Scotland, Ireland, Wales and British America, and of English Books Printed in Other Countries, 1641-1700, the essential bibliographic database of extant books, pamphlets, and broadsides printed in English between 1641 and 1700, known universally as Wing. This revised edition of Wing expands the 1972 edition with the restoration of lost entries, expansion of cross references, and the addition of new material. The CD-ROM gives unprecedented access to over 100,000 entries providing the title, author name, imprint, bibliographic information, and physical format of the item. It also lists selected libraries and institutions that hold a copy of the work.
